This video explores the linguistic diversity of India, which is home to hundreds of languages and dialects that come from many different language families. The video covers the six largest language families spoken in India, including Indo-European, Dravidian, Austroasiatic, Sino-Tibetan, Tai-Kadai, and Andamanese, as well as a few unique languages not found anywhere else on earth.

The Indo-European language family is the largest language family in the world, and over 70% of the Indian population speaks a language from this family, including Hindi, Bengali, Punjabi, Marathi, Gujarati, Kashmiri, Assamese, and Oriya. The Dravidian language family is the second largest language family in India, with over 200 million speakers, including Tamil, Telugu, Kannada, and Malayalam.

The Austroasiatic language family is one of the oldest language families in India, with a history dating back over 3,500 years. This language family includes languages like Santali, Mundari, and Khasi, and is predominantly spoken in the northeastern region of India. The Sino-Tibetan language family is one of the largest language families in the world, with over 400 languages spoken across Asia. In India, some of the most commonly spoken Sino-Tibetan languages include Manipuri, Bodo, and Tibetan, and these languages are mainly spoken in the northeastern region of India.

The Tai-Kadai language family is predominantly spoken in Southeast Asia, but it also includes languages spoken in parts of Northeast India, such as Thai and Lao. The Andamanese language family is spoken in the Andaman Islands and the nearby Nicobar Islands, and some of the most commonly spoken Andamanese languages include Great Andamanese and Onge. Unfortunately, many of the languages in the Austroasiatic and Andamanese language families are at risk of extinction.

In addition to these language families, India has a few language isolates, such as Nihali, Burushaski, and Kusunda. Nihali is one of the oldest languages in India, with a unique phonological and grammatical structure, and Burushaski is known for its complex verbs and sentence structure. Kusunda has a unique phonological and grammatical structure and is believed to be one of the oldest languages in the region.

This video showcases the rich linguistic and cultural diversity of India and highlights the importance of preserving these languages for future generations.
